Clifford O'Neal Allen, 60, of Newton died Monday, February 19, 2018 at Phoebe Putney Memorial Hospital in Albany.

Funeral services will be 11:00 a.m. Friday, February 23 at Travelers Rest Freewill Baptist Church with interment in the church cemetery. Rev. David Wolfe and Rev. Malcolm Parker will officiate.

Born July 20, 1957 in Mitchell County, Mr. Allen was the son of the late Robert Allen and Betty Musgrove Bentley. He was a member of Travelers Rest Freewill Baptist Church. Mr. Allen worked with the Department of Agriculture for the State of Georgia. He was preceded in death by a sister, Rena Kimbrell and twin sisters, Becky Wynell Bentley and Betsy Wynette Bentley.

Survivors include his wife, Diane Allen of Newton; four sons, Daniel Allen, James Aultman (Amanda), Lucas Allen (Lindsey), and Glen Allen (Amanda); two daughters, Priscilla Tucker and Susan Aultman; four sisters, Wanda Cramer, Rose Marshall, Sherry Corn, Stacy Rowell; one brother, Wesley Allen; and 14 grandchildren.

Visitation will be from 6 to 8 p.m. Thursday, February 22 at Parker-Bramlett Funeral Home in Camilla.

Memorials may be made to Travelers Rest Freewill Baptist Church, 3784 Travelers Rest Rd., Newton, GA 39870.

Parker-Bramlett Funeral Home is in charge of arrangements.
